ChannelFactoryBase.DefaultReceiveTimeout Właściwość

Definicja

Pobiera domyślny interwał czasu podany dla operacji odbierania do ukończenia.

protected:
 virtual property TimeSpan DefaultReceiveTimeout { TimeSpan get(); };
protected public:
 virtual property TimeSpan DefaultReceiveTimeout { TimeSpan get(); };
protected override TimeSpan DefaultReceiveTimeout { get; }
protected internal override TimeSpan DefaultReceiveTimeout { get; }
member this.DefaultReceiveTimeout : TimeSpan
Protected Overrides ReadOnly Property DefaultReceiveTimeout As TimeSpan
Protected Friend Overrides ReadOnly Property DefaultReceiveTimeout As TimeSpan

Wartość właściwości

TimeSpan

Wartość domyślna TimeSpan określająca, jak długo operacja odbierania musi zostać ukończona przed przekroczeniem limitu czasu.

Uwagi

Ta wartość jest ustawiana podczas tworzenia nowego ChannelFactoryBase obiektu. Domyślny ChannelFactoryBase() konstruktor ustawia DefaultReceiveTimeout właściwość na wartość 10 minut. Użyj polecenia ChannelFactoryBase(IDefaultCommunicationTimeouts) , jeśli chcesz określić inną wartość dla tego limitu czasu.

Dotyczy